Reports Report 10412d (Event 10412-2025)

Observer
Name Michelle G
Experience Level 2/5
Remarks it looked the falling parts of fireworks but there was only one and NO sound. white tip with goldenish tail, tail was not very long. seemed to be so close that I watched for something to be on fire from the landing. it appeared out of nowhere then was gone in just a few seconds.
